Gripped aggressive foreign bodies (magnetic balls) in the gastrointestinal tract require emergency actions to clarify their localization and to remove them. The conservative approach with four-day observation described in the article should not be used.</p><p><bold>Introduction</bold>. Internal fistulas in foreign bodies of the digestive tract is a very rare complication.</p><p>This publication is aimed to describe a rare case of fistula formation between the vermiform process and the ileum caused by magnetic foreign bodies.</p><p><bold>Clinical observation</bold>. As his parents said, a 2-year-old child swallowed magnetic balls; no clinical manifestations were noted. Plain radiography 3 days after the ingestion revealed foreign bodies (3) in the right lower quadrant of the abdomen. No foreign bodies were found on colonoscopy. Laparoscopy revealed a fistula between the appendix and the terminal ileum. The following steps were made: disconnection of fistula, appendectomy, suturing of fistula opening in the ileum.</p><p><bold>Conclusion</bold>. One of the complications after swallowing magnetic foreign bodies may be formation of internal intestinal fistulas. In our observation, the fistula was between the appendix and the ileum. No similar observations were found in literature.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="ru"><p>КОММЕНТАРИЙ РЕДАКЦИИ.
